RIC FLAIR RETURNS TO THE RING (AGAIN), WWE STARTS EARLY THIS SUNDAY AND MORE

By Buck Woodward on 2011-01-21 09:00:00

Big weekend for TNA, as they kick off their European tour in France with a crew that includes Ric Flair wrestling on the events.  Interesting to note that while both Jeff and Matt Hardy are on the tour, they are not scheduled for any tag team matches together this coming week.   WWE has both Raw and Smackdown crews on the road here in the U.S. with them wisely scheduling their Sunday events for 1pm.  With the NFL Playoffs starting at 3pm, this is probably a wise move, as fans can still go to the show and not miss much of the first game. 

The Raw crew starts their run tonight, January 21st at the Sun National Bank Center in Trenton, New Jersey with WWE Champion The Miz vs. Randy Orton and John Cena vs. CM Punk as the main events.

Raw then runs on Saturday, January 22nd at the Bryce Jordan Center in State College, Pennsylvania with Miz vs. Orton and U.S. Champion Daniel Bryan vs. Ted DiBiase vs. John Morrison.  John Cena vs. Wade Barrett was listed for the show, but I expect that to be changed to Cena vs. CM Punk, since Barrett is now listed for the Smackdown show in Michigan that night. 

Raw runs on Sunday, January 23rd at the Covelli Centre in Youngstown, Ohio with a 1pm start time and the following matches advertised:
- WWE Champion The Miz vs. Randy Orton.
- John Cena vs. CM Punk.
- U.S. Champion Daniel Bryan vs. Ted DiBiase. 

Raw broadcasts on Monday, January 24th from the Joe Louis Arena in Detroit, Michigan with WWE Champion The Miz vs. World Champion Edge.

The Smackdown crew starts their run on Saturday, January 22nd at Wings Stadium in Kalamazoo, Michigan with World Champion Edge vs. Kane vs. Dolph Ziggler and Big Show vs. Wade Barrett on top.

Smackdown runs on Sunday, January 23rd at the Hammond Civic Center in Hammond, Indiana with a 1pm start time. 

Smackdown tapes on Tuesday, January 25th at the US Bank Arena in Cincinnati, Ohio, the final WWE TV taping before the Royal Rumble.

TNA starts their European tour today, January 21st in Lyon, France with the following advertised matches on top:
- World Champion Mr. Anderson vs. Jeff Hardy vs. Rob Van Dam.
- World Tag Team Champions Beer Money vs. The Motor City Machine Guns.  Given Alex Shelley's injury, this match might be changed.
- Matt Morgan vs. D'Angelo Dinero. 
- Kazarian, Jeff Jarrett, Ric Flair, Kurt Angle, Matt Hardy, Madison Rayne, Douglas Williams, Mickie James, Shannon Moore, Angelina Love, Tara and Mark Haskins are also listed as appearing.

Here are the advertised matches for the rest of the shows:

1/22: Paris, France
- World Champion Mr. Anderson vs. Jeff Hardy.
- World Tag Team Champions Beer Money vs. The Motor City Machine Guns. 
- Rob Van Dam vs. Matt Hardy.

1/24: Dublin, Ireland
- World Champion Mr. Anderson vs. Jeff Hardy vs. Jeff Jarrett.
- World Tag Team Champions Beer Money vs. The Motor City Machine Guns. 
- Rob Van Dam vs. Matt Hardy.
- Madison Rayne & Tara vs. Mickie James & Angelina Love.

1/25: Berlin, Germany
- World Champion Mr. Anderson vs. Jeff Hardy.
- World Tag Team Champions Beer Money vs. The Motor City Machine Guns. 
- Rob Van Dam & Matt Morgan vs. Matt Hardy & D'Angelo Dinero.

1/27: Glasgow, Scotland
- World Champion Mr. Anderson vs. Jeff Hardy.
- Ric Flair & Kazarian vs. Douglas Williams & Matt Morgan.
- World Tag Team Champions Beer Money vs. The Motor City Machine Guns.
- Rob Van Dam vs. Matt Hardy.
- Jeff Jarrett vs. Scotland's own Lionheart (note, NOT Chris Jericho) with Scottish comedian Greg Hemphill as the referee.

TNA's tour finishes up in England with shows in Manchester and London next weekend.
